A new hearing loop system for the deaf was inaugurated at Ta’ Pinu Sanctuary before Mass led by Gozo Bishop Mario Grech with the participation of members of the Gozo Association of the Deaf and the Deaf People Association of Malta.

The new system, inaugurated by Parliamentary Secretary Justyne Caruana, magnetically transmit sound to hearing aids and cochlear implants with wireless loudspeakers, delivering a clear customised sound.

Hearing-impaired people, who followed the Mass via a live broadcast on TVM2, were also able to follow the service with sign language.
